Professor Ian Frazer, who developed the HPV vaccine, says allowing the “controlled” spread of COVID-19 is the only way to get through the pandemic while Australians wait for a vaccine. 

The University of Queensland immunologist advocates a gradual easing of lockdown restrictions while gaining some herd immunity in a controlled way, as a vaccine is at least 12-18 months away.
